On Wyzant, you can find tutors who specialize in teaching study skills in Worcester, MA. Whether you're looking to develop better organization, time management, note-taking, or test-preparation techniques, Wyzant connects you with flexible, personalized tutoring sessions both in person and online.
Learning study skills helps students stay organized, focused, and confident in their coursework. Practice can span reading strategies, note-taking, planning, prioritizing tasks, or building effective study routines. Each session is tailored to meet your specific needs and goals.
